Gain a deeper understanding of the challenges and strengths of people living in poverty. This one-day workshop based on the work of Dr. Ruby Payne, PhD will help you partner with individuals to create opportunities for success. You will:
- Examine the impact of poverty on families;
- Explore the hidden rules of economic class;
- Identify ways to improve relationships;
- Develop new tools to better address individuals' needs.
